| 'Kara' resembles 'Tokudama Flavocircinalis' (possibly more vigorous) but is larger and has rounder leaves. It can reach a size of 26" wide and 14" high, with leaves measuring 6x5". They are cordate and rugose and blue-green in color with a yellow margin. They have 13 veins. Scapes reach 16" and are tall and bare, with medium, bell-shaped white flowers. It is fertile. Sometimes labelled 'Kara G', the letter "G" stands for Giboshi (Japanese for Hosta) and should be removed. |
